Designer Sanu K R has designed a transportation vehicle that looks like it's out of a futuristic movie. After receiving his education from the Keltron Advanced Design Center in India, Sanu went on to design a variety of items, from household tools to single person flotation devices.
This particular design is a single-person pod that is slim, and has just enough room for someone to sit in. Instead of a steering wheel, this vehicle is controlled by a joystick, similar to the way someone plays a video game. To get in and out of the solo pod, one must open the circular doors, which resemble that of a submarines.
The single-person pod designed by Sanu K R would be perfect for crowded city transportation.
